The Need for Diverse Capital Mobilisation in Southeast Asia

Southeast Asia, particularly Indonesia, is on a path to achieving significant economic growth. To reach ambitious targets, the region must embrace diverse capital mobilisation strategies. As countries within ASEAN work towards recovery and growth post-pandemic, the focus is on expanding funding avenues that can support various sectors, from infrastructure to technology.

The Current Economic Landscape

Indonesia's economic landscape remains vibrant, with the government aiming for a double-digit GDP growth rate. However, achieving such growth requires innovative financing strategies that involve both local and foreign investors.
